Shake in Idle when AC is on
hey I've a 91 DA and it just started recently shaking in idle when the AC is on. The shake isnt excessively bad but it's something I want to fix. What would cause this? As soon as I give it gas, and the rpms raise, the shake goes away. And it only shakes when the AC is on! I know JACK about AC and I'm barely getting in hondas now.

It's the A/C compressor putting a load on the engine, causing it to run a little rough. It's normal on an older car. My '95 GSR does it. It got really bad after I put in solid mounts.
